Madonna to play London at end of November

LONDON--Madonna has announced that she will play her first British show in seven years at London’s Brixton Academy on Nov. 28. Support for the one-off event is to be provided by former Verve frontman Richard Ashcroft , rockers Texas and Prodigy star Liam Howlett DJing.

No tickets are available for the private gig at which Madonna is expected to perform songs from her album "Music" for an audience of up to 3,000. The confirmation of her London show follows her five-song set at New York’s Roseland Ballroom on Nov. 5.

U.K. tabloids have also reported that the pop queen is tipped to do an in-store signing at the HMV record store in London’s Oxford Street on Nov. 24. However, a spokesperson for Madonna told liveDaily that the rumor is not confirmed.

"Music," Madonna's tenth studio LP is currently at No. 17 after seven weeks on the Official U.K. Album Chart. It has sold over 600,000 copies in Britain to date and has been certified double-platinum.
